 Another sketch, this time from Oct 25th/26th 2025 of Lemmon observed from a very dark location called Beaghmore Stone Circles in the Sperrins of N. Ireland. I was shocked how much more tail I could see this night, three of us were observing it in binoculars  at once and admiring the beauty of the tail.
 
 
 
 
 10x42mm binos, gas tail 9 degrees long visually, extending rite into the naked eye stars of Corona Borealis. With naked eye comet seen as a stationary glowing streak of light, tail observed to 9 or 10 degrees without optical aid using averted vision (only seen  twice at this length during moments of great clarity), I was surprised by this. At a rough estimate it was fist size at arm's length.
 
 
 
 
 Coma DC:8, green on sunward side, dust and gas tails superimposed on one another. Comet was really gorgeous, this was my best view of it yet.
